Gary Hester Wins Carolina's Open
Tune-Up Tournament

21 April 2001 - Anderson, S.C. - With the Carolina's Open tournament to be played on Sunday, 40 players faced off in the warm-up tournament for both the North and South Carolina tours. It was only fitting that the defending champion of the Carolina's Open would win the tune-up event.

Hole 13 (Course 2) in Anderson, South Carolina.

Gary Hester, 2000 Carolina's Open Champion, won by one shot over Greg Newport and Greg Ward, previous winners held in Anderson this year. Newport and Hester were tied at 59 after two rounds, with Ward one shot back. After Ward fired a final round 31 to finish at 91, Newport took himself out with a triple bogey five on hole 13 and Hester went to 17 with a two-stroke lead. Hester lagged the hill and took a bogey three. Then, on 18 with a one-shot lead, Hester lined his tee shot up and bounced off the back of the hole and landed in the corner on the left side. He made his deuce from there to win by one shot at 90.

Gary Hester, 2000 Carolina's Open Champion.

Hester's win is his third in the last two seasons. All three of his wins since returning to the state level in 1996 have come in the realms of both the North and South Carolina tour program in a combined event format.

Chris Hudson battled in the APA Division against Tommy Hutchinson and won by two strokes over Hutchinson. Hudson fired a second round 29 to trail Hutchinson by one shot, then fired a final round 30 to win by two shots over Hutchinson. The win for Hudson is his second this year in South Carolina and the first this year in North Carolina. Hudson should be one of the favorites this Sunday in Anderson as he finished the day at 18-under par 90. Hutchinson shot 92 to finish in second and Brian Hutchins and Steve Helton both wound up tied for third at 103.

Newport and Ward each finished one back of Hester at 91 in a tie for second. Michael Hitt fired a score of 92 to finish in the fourth position on Saturday, and Mike Brown and Randy Reeves rounded out the top five with a final score of 93.

There were 20 money spots paid out in the Pro Division with the score of 99 receiving a four-way split for the 20th spot. The APA cash line was 103 with a two-player split for that spot.

With the victory on Saturday, Hester took all of the available spots offered by both the North and South Carolina tours. He accepted the North Carolina State Qualifying and Match Play spots. The same holds true for South Carolina.

The two tours will compete again this Sunday, April 22, at 9:00am in Anderson for the Carolina's Open. Hester will be out there to defend his title.
